  • What does the term 'percent' mean?
    'Out of 100'
  • How do you convert 5% to a fraction?
    5/100
  • How can you express 5% as a decimal?
    0.05
  • How do you convert the fraction 19/36 to a percentage?
    Divide 19 by 36 and multiply by 100
  • What is the result of dividing 19 by 36?
    0.52777778
  • How do you convert 0.52777778 to a percentage?
    Multiply by 100
  • What is 0.52777778 as a percentage?
    52.777778%
  • What does a ratio indicate?
    Comparison of one thing to another
  • How is a betting ratio expressed?
    As odds, e.g., 4 to 1
  • What is a part-to-part ratio?
    A ratio like 4:1
  • What is a part-to-whole ratio?
    A ratio like 4:5
  • How can a part-to-whole ratio be expressed as a fraction?
    As
  • How can ratios be simplified?
    By dividing both parts by a common factor
  • What is the simplified form of the ratio 10:15?
    2:3
  • Why is estimation useful in calculations?
    To detect potential mistakes
  • How can you estimate the product of 185,363 and 46,208?
    Round to 200,000 and 50,000
  • What is the estimated product of 200,000 and 50,000?
    10,000,000,000
  • Why is the actual answer smaller than the estimated product?
    Because both numbers were rounded up
  • What is the actual product of 185,363 and 46,208?
    8,565,253,504

  • What is standard form?
    Representation of numbers as powers of 10
  • How is 8,600,000,000 expressed in standard form?
    8.6 x 10⁹
  • How is 0.0045 expressed in standard form?
    4.5 x 10⁻³

  • What are the types of data in research?
    • Primary data: Collected for current investigation
    • Secondary data: Collected by others
    • Quantitative data: Numerical data for statistical analysis
    • Qualitative data: Non-numerical, language-based data
